Pricing gaffes are quite common on digital storefronts, but we reckon that Sony will be ruing the error that it made with Killzone: Shadow Fall overnight. Originally spotted by money saving specialists Hot UK Deals – and verified by a slew of excited Twitter accounts all over the web – Guerrilla Games’ first-person exclusive could be purchased for just £0.85 ($1.42) from the British PlayStation Store in the early hours of this morning.

The blunder – which has now been rectified – allowed tight players to download the entire 38.2GB game after purchasing the cheap and cheerful Mercenary Playercard Icon Pack. Considering that the title ordinarily retails for an outrageous £52.99, that’s some saving. It’s not entirely clear whether the console maker will honour the deal, but we reckon that it would be a bit shady if it doesn’t. After all, this is only going to aid the outing’s already impressive sales numbers.
